Facilities Engineer plans and implements the design of plants, offices, and production lines in order to maximize the use of available space and improve production efficiency. Estimates costs related to layout design, including equipment and materials, labor, etc. and monitors the construction process. Being a Facilities Engineer researches production/processing equipment or fixtures for purchase and gathers data relating to their ability to meet organizational needs. Ensures that established efficiency and safety targets are met. Additionally, Facilities Engineer typically requires a bachelor's degree in engineering.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. To be a Facilities Engineer typically requires 0-2 years of related experience. Works on projects/matters of limited complexity in a support role. Work is closely managed.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
About Amp Americas
Founded in 2011, Amp Americas builds, manages, operates and maintains RNG production facilities that convert dairy waste into carbon-negative hydrogen, renewable transportation fuel and power. The vertically-integrated company leverages over a decade of unique expertise and specialized experience in carbon-negative fuel development, operations, services and marketing to deliver comprehensive, turn-key solutions that address greenhouse gas emissions and seek to improve air, land and water quality. Position Summary
The Facilites Engineer is responsible for ensuring safe operation of our RNG assets, maximizing uptime and production, as well as optimizing reliability and performance. This position reports directly to the Sr. Director of Operations. The incumbent will collaborate extensively with the operations and engineering staff through regular on-site support to troubleshoot issues impacting throughput or yield, commission new plants, and implement process and technology improvements at our facilities by designing, specifying, and implementing process improvement projects. The incumbent must be skilled in vendor management and familiar with common gas processing equipment. A results-oriented, self-motivated engineer is needed to work cross-functionally to support or lead a diverse set of project and/or operational tasks that may arise in a start-up environment.
